A French submarine and a U.S. submarine move toward each other during maneuvers in motionless water in the North Atlantic. The French sub moves at speed Vf, and the U.S. sub at speed Vus". The French sub sends out a sonar signal (sound wave in water) at 1.000 x10^3 Hz. Sonar waves travel at 5470 km/h. The U.S sub detects a frequency of 1022.140Hz. The French sub detects the signal reflected back to it by the U.S sub at a frequency of 1044.854Hz.

What are the speeds of the U.S. and the French subs? Identify which sub is the source and which one is the observer and show it in a sketch for each of the cases when the signal is detected by the U.S. sub and for when the signal is detected by the French sub. And then use the appropriate signs in the formula F ' = [(V± Vo)/(V± Vs)]f in each case.
